Who is paul mcbride qc?

User Avatar

Asked by Wiki User

Paul McBride, QC, 40, went to Strathclyde University aged 16 to read law. He graduated at 19 and spent the next two years on a traineeship with a solicitors' firm in Ayrshire. He then "deviled" for nine months (the equivalent of the English pupillage) and became a barrister at 22.

In 1998 he took silk aged 35, the youngest QC ever appointed in the UK .

"When I started at the Bar I wanted to do civil work. But you are not in control of what work you get as an advocate so I went to the Criminal Appeal Court and ended up co-writing Criminal Appeals with Lord McClusky. Looking back, there is little I would change. When I decided to go to the Bar, wiser heads said to me: 'You are far too young, you have no contacts, no experience, you are not wealthy, the Bar can't cope with any more than about 70 people.' That is all rubbish. "I don't know anyone in the English or Scottish Bar who has ability and doesn't do well. People wanting to come to the Bar are always told it is doom, gloom, no legal aid, no work. It is not true. There is always a place for people who are determined and talented." Source: http://business.timesonline.co.uk/tol/business/law/student/article578693.ece As one of the most successful criminal defence Counsel in the country Paul is regularly involved in the highest profile criminal case reported in this country, such as: - The Nat Fraser murder trial - The Moira Jones murder trial - The Chokar trial - The head on the beach murder - The largest drugs importation cases in Scotland He also specialises in regulatory crime. Recently he was involved in the first UK public inquiry into the Stockline tragedy in Glasgow and also the Castle Craig fatal accident inquiry. Paul has also been instructed in the Rosepark fatal accident inquiry.

He has a number of further appointments an interests including:

- Standing senior counsel for the Police Association and the Prison Officers' Association - Standing counsel for the Gamekeepers' Association - Senior counsel to the Trinity Mirror Group and News quest Group - Instructed by The Lord Advocate to be the first Counsel to attend the new Supreme Court for the Crown - Advisor to the Conservative Party on Scottish and UK Law and Order - Author of only book on Criminal Appeals in Scotland Source: http://www.paulmcbrideqc.com/about-paul-mcbride-qc/default.aspx
